Common Causes Behind Shoulder Pain
- Rotator cuff injuries
- Frozen Shoulder and stiffness
- Ligament injuries treated by a Ligament Tear Specialist
- Sports-related injuries
- Age-related joint degeneration
Symptoms You Should Watch For
- Pain while lifting or rotating the arm
- Stiffness and reduced range of motion
- Swelling or tenderness
- Pain during sleep
- Weakness in the shoulder
